This definitive series of volumes is the most comprehensive and authoritative body of knowledge in existence on invertebrate fossil groups. For each fossil group, these volumes describe and illustrate: morphological features, with special reference to hard parts; ontogeny; classification; geologic distribution; evolutionary trends and phylogeny; and systematic descriptions. There are a great many detailed illustrations and plates throughout the series. Two-volume set (vols. 2 & 3) of the extensive six-volume revision of the Brachiopoda. Contains an introductory chapter with the brachiopod classification, systematic descriptions for the phylum as well as the subphyla Linguiliformea, Craniiformea, and part of the Rhynchonelliformea, including classes Chileata, Obolellata, Kutorginata, Strophomenata, and Rhynochonellata. There are a great many detailed illustrations and plates throughout the series. This is the fourth volume published in an extensive six-volume revision of the phylum Brachiopoda. Included in this volume is the second part of the subphylum Rhynchonelliformea (including the orders Pentamerida, Rhynchonellida, Atrypida, and Athyridida), followed by a comprehensive reference list and index.
